    Career Insights: Senior Development in Financial Services IT
Working for BOC IT Solutions places a developer at the heart of the financial technology sector, where high standards of security, reliability, and performance are paramount. The requirement for certification in technologies like **C# and .net** alongside **JavaScript, HTML, and CSS** suggests a focus on full-stack development, likely involving robust enterprise applications and internal banking systems.
The five years of experience required indicates this is a leadership-level technical role, demanding deep expertise and the ability to solve complex problems independently. The preference for **PMP** (Project Management Professional) and **ITIL Foundation** shows the company values developers who also understand project delivery methodologies and IT service management principles, crucial for working within a large corporate group like BOC.
